titleOfInvention Imidazo-isoquinolin-5-one derivatives, pyrimido-isoquinolin-6-one derivatives and imidazo-naphthyridin-5-one derivatives
abstract Antiatherosclerotic compounds are provided which have the following structure:wherein:R is hydrogen, lower alkyl, alkenyl, alkynyl, aryl, heteroaryl, or aryl or heteroaryl substituted with one or more members of the group consisting of alkyl, hydroxy, alkoxy, perfluoroalkyl, perfluoroalkoxy, alkylthio, nitro, amino, mono or di-alkylamino, and halogen;D is C-H, carbon bound to R5 or nitrogen;R1, R2, R3, and R4 are each independently hydrogen, alkyl, or taken together form a ring;R5 is one or more groups selected from hydrogen, alkyl, alkenyl, alkynyl, aryl, hydroxy, alkoxy, perfluoroalkyl, perfluoroalkoxy, alkylthio, nitro, amino, mono or di-alkylamino, or halogen;n is an integer of 0-3;or pharmaceutically acceptable salts thereof.
